Several analytic approaches predict for SU(N c )Yang-Mills theories in Landau gauge an enhanced ghost propagator G(p 2 )and a suppressed gluon propagator D(p 2 )at small momenta. This prediction applies to two, three and four space-time dimensions. Moreover, the gluon propagator is predicted to be null at p = 0.
